BMW Concept 4-series Coupe (2012) first photos
Tue, 04 Dec 2012BMW is overhauling the 3-series Coupe - it'll be replaced in 2013 by the new 4-series Coupe and Convertible, previewed in this remarkably production-ready concept car. Munich reserves the 'Concept' moniker for its show cars which are in reality showroom ready. So strip away the sexed-up exhausts, 20in wheels and other trinkets and what you're looking at here is the new 2013 BMW 4-series.
Land Rover starts voyage of Discovery with Virgin Galactic (2014)
Tue, 15 Apr 2014By Phil McNamara First Official Pictures 15 April 2014 09:30 Land Rover took a giant leap in New York last night, unveiling a concept car vision of the new Discovery family and announcing a partnership with Virgin Galactic. The Discovery was revealed on the deck of the USS Intrepid aircraft carrier alongside Virgin's SpaceShipTwo, the rocketship charged with making space tourism a commercial reality. Land Rover's SUVs will be the taxi of choice for budding, wealthy astronauts, attending Virgin's New Mexico base for training and space flights.
